How they compare

United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land currently reports 41.85 against 41.81 in France, a difference of 0.04.

The two have swapped places 2 times across 10 shared years of data; in 2005 it was United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land ahead.

France ranks 30th and United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land ranks 29th of 107 countries.

United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ade France United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land Difference Ahead
2000s 39.75 41.19 1.44 United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land
2010s 41 41.36 0.3578 United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
